Chassis, Suspension, Brakes & Wheels

FrametypeRectangular Section Single Beam
FrontbrakesDouble disc
Frontbrakesdiameter320 mm (12.6 inches)
FrontsuspensionUSD fork, 43 mm fully adjustable
Fronttyre120/70-17
Rake23.5°
RearbrakesSingle disc
Rearbrakesdiameter282 mm (11.1 inches)
RearsuspensionSingle sided swing arm with fully adjustable mono shock
Reartyre180/55-17

Engine & Transmission

Compression9.8:1
CoolingsystemAir
Displacement1064.00 ccm (64.93 cubic inches)
EnginedetailsV2, four-stroke
ExhaustsystemStainless steel exhaust system
FuelsystemInjection. Weber-Marelli electronic injection with stepper motor
IgnitionElectronic digital ignition. Twin spark
LubricationsystemWet sump, forced oil, cartridge filter
Power88.00 HP (64.2 kW)) @ 8000 RPM
Torque94.92 Nm (9.7 kgf-m or 70.0 ft.lbs) @ 5400 RPM
Valvespercylinder2

Other Specifications

StarterElectric

Physical Measures & Capacities

Dryweight229.0 kg (504.8 pounds)
Fuelcapacity17.03 litres (4.50 gallons)
Overalllength2,250 mm (88.6 inches)
Overallwidth870 mm (34.3 inches)
Powerweightratio0.3843 HP/kg
Seatheight790 mm (31.1 inches) If adjustable, lowest setting.

About Moto Guzzi Griso 2006

Introducing the 2006 Moto Guzzi Griso, a striking figure in the sport motorcycle category that embodies the perfect blend of Italian craftsmanship and innovative engineering. With a starting price of around $13,490, the Griso stands out not just for its aesthetics but also for its performance capabilities, appealing to both seasoned riders and those new to the Moto Guzzi brand. This motorcycle is designed for enthusiasts who appreciate a unique character and a powerful presence on the road, making it an attractive option for those looking to elevate their riding experience.

At the heart of the Griso lies a robust 1064cc V2, four-stroke engine that produces an impressive 88 horsepower at 8,000 RPM and a torque of 94.92 Nm at a manageable 5,400 RPM. This configuration not only delivers exhilarating acceleration but also ensures a smooth ride across various terrains. Riders can expect a thrilling experience, thanks to the bike's excellent power-to-weight ratio of 0.3843 HP/kg, which translates into agile handling and responsive performance. The Griso's air-cooled engine is paired with a sophisticated Weber-Marelli electronic fuel injection system, delivering precise throttle response and fuel efficiency that enhances the overall riding experience.

The 2006 Griso is packed with features that demonstrate Moto Guzzi's commitment to technology and rider comfort. The chassis boasts a rectangular section single beam frame, which contributes to its rigidity and stability while cornering. Up front, the fully adjustable USD fork and dual 320 mm disc brakes provide confidence-inspiring handling and stopping power. At the rear, the single-sided swing arm with a fully adjustable mono shock ensures a comfortable ride without sacrificing performance. With a seat height of 790 mm, the Griso caters to a wide range of riders, providing an accessible and commanding riding position.

PROs:

  1. Unique Design: The Griso's aesthetic appeal and distinctive styling set it apart from other sport motorcycles, making it a head-turner on the road.
  2. Powerful Engine: The V2 engine delivers impressive power and torque, offering exhilarating performance for spirited rides and highway cruising.
  3. Adjustable Suspension: Fully adjustable suspension components enhance rider comfort and handling, allowing customization to suit different riding styles and preferences.

CONs:

  1. Weight: At 229 kg (504.8 lbs), the Griso may feel heavy for some riders, particularly at low speeds or during maneuvers.
  2. Limited Storage: The Griso’s design prioritizes style and performance over practicality, resulting in minimal storage options for everyday use.
  3. Niche Appeal: As a unique offering from Moto Guzzi, its distinct character may not appeal to all riders, particularly those favoring traditional sportbike aesthetics.
